AInvest Newsletter
Daily stocks & crypto headlines, free to your inbox
The stock of Constellation Brands (STZ) has dipped slightly in recent trading sessions, reflecting a mixed market mood. With bearish signals prevailing in the technical landscape and analyst ratings split between cautious optimism and strong buy, investors are weighing the fundamentals against uncertain chart patterns.
Recent news highlights several developments potentially affecting the broader beverage and consumer goods sector:
The average analyst rating for
is 3.92 (simple mean), and 4.31 when weighted by historical performance—both indicating cautious optimism. However, this optimism is not reflected in recent price action, which has seen a -0.65% drop, suggesting a mismatch between expectations and current sentiment.On the fundamentals, the model scores reflect a strong base for the company:
While the PB and ROA remain strong, the negative ROE and ROE growth rate suggest earnings pressure. The Cash-UP score of 1.00 highlights good liquidity, but bearish momentum in the technicals could pressure earnings further.
Big-money players appear cautious, with the Large-inflow ratio at 46.23%, and a negative trend in the block flow (47.82% inflow ratio). Meanwhile, retail (Small) flows are positive at 50.76% inflow ratio. This suggests that while retail investors remain optimistic, institutional money is withdrawing or locking in gains.
The fund-flow score of 7.82 (internal diagnostic score, 0-10) indicates a generally healthy flow, but the negative Medium and Extra-large trends reinforce the bearish technical picture.
Two key technical indicators are currently active:
Over the last 5 days, WR Oversold has appeared frequently (on 8/21, 8/19, 8/18, and 8/20), signaling potential short-term volatility but limited directional clarity.
Key technical insights include:
With a technical score of 3.21 (internal diagnostic score) and a bearish trend, traders are advised to proceed with caution or avoid the stock for now.
Constellation Brands presents a mixed outlook: strong fundamentals and positive retail inflows contrast with bearish technical signals and institutional caution. The 7.82 fund-flow score and 8.92 fundamental score (both internal diagnostic scores) suggest a fundamentally sound business but one currently facing headwinds from market sentiment and weak momentum indicators.
Actionable takeaway: Consider holding off on new entries or waiting for a clearer breakout to the upside. Monitor the company's upcoming earnings and the reaction to the latest analyst comments from high-performing institutions like
and JP Morgan.A quantitative finance AI researcher dedicated to uncovering winning stock strategies through rigorous backtesting and data-driven analysis.

Dec.18 2025

Dec.18 2025

Dec.18 2025

Dec.18 2025

Dec.18 2025
Daily stocks & crypto headlines, free to your inbox
Comments
No comments yet